Subject: Pilot Update — Bramblewick Stores

Team, a careful summary for our incoming director. The eight-week pilot with the Bramblewick chain is now live in four branches. Early basket data looks encouraging, though shelf placement remains inconsistent. We meet their merchandising lead next week to agree corrective steps. Wider strategic implications, for your eyes only, are noted directly below.

board note of kagep-yahig: Only 9 of the 120 pilot accounts renewed Quenix, so a churn review is set for April 1.

Ticket: Staging env misconfigured for Siftgate bloom filter

The bloom layer in front of the Pellet KV store is rejecting all lookups in staging because the env file was copied from the dev template without credentials. False-positive tuning values are fine; only the auth line is missing. To unblock the weekly demo, the Pellet admission secret must be set on the following line.

env line for yaguf-fajop: LEDGER_TOKEN13=fb08984397349

Subject: Cut-over complete — contrast audit tooling

Team,

The cut-over to the new Lanterloo contrast-audit service finished last night. All customer-facing pages are now checked against the stricter ratio thresholds, and the legacy checker has been retired. If a customer reports a page flagged that previously passed, that's expected — the new thresholds are tighter, not a bug. For reference when answering tickets, the audit service now runs with the settings below.

settings of fafog-haduf:
ZORIX_PIN=4648
ZORIX_METRICS_HOST=metrics.zorix.paliqsys.corp
ZORIX_LOG_LEVEL=info
ZORIX_TENANT=druix